If this isn't initialized and an idle watch gets instanced before meta_idle_monitor_native_reset_idletime() gets called, that idle watch would get triggered as soon as we hit the main loop. This was causing gnome-session to go into idle mode at session start thus making gnome-shell lock the screen. In the past this bug was being masked by either logind emiting session active signals or a stray input event making it through at startup. https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=772839
